sftp and ftps perform the same function but are entirely different protocols.

ftps is the secure extension to ftp. It is identical to the relation that https and http have. It is a newcomer so not many existing ftp servers support it. You would need an upgrade or a replacement of your ftp server to support ftps client connections.

sftp on the other hand is part of the ssh suit and the connection is handled by the ssh daemon.

I have not seen a detailed feature comparison between ftps and sftp you would have to look at the detailed feature description of each client to compare them. All the features you mentioned are possible to some extend with both products.
